What is another word for Feting?

Pronunciation: [fˈe͡ɪtɪŋ] (IPA)

The word "feting" is often used to describe the act of celebrating or honoring someone or something. There are several synonyms for this word, including "commemorating," "applauding," "lauding," "honoring," "recognizing," "saluting," "toasting," and "cheering." Each of these words conveys a sense of admiration or appreciation for someone or something, typically by publicly acknowledging their achievements or qualities. Whether it's an individual or a group that is being feted, these synonyms all capture the spirit of celebration and honor that is associated with this word.
